The computer turns on, and goes all the way to the blue user log-in screen. However, when I tried to log in, it went normally, but it never gets around to displaying the desktop. Instead, (with the mouse cursor still movable) it sits there displaying just the wallpaper, and then after that logs itself off. More log-in attempts just result in the same thing, just faster

I'm not sure where the problem comes from, so I'll just say all of what I did

1. Updated Lavasoft Ad-Aware 6 and Spybot: S&
2. Started an Ad-Aware scan, but ended it a few seconds after because I wanted to run msconfig
3. Ran the Microsoft Configuration Utility (msconfig) and set it to a Diagnostic Startup, and clicked "ok"
4. Waited for a while, then when the "Restart" or "Exit Without Restart" choices popped up, I chose "Restart
5. Restarted fine, and also logged in fine here
6. Ran Ad-Aware (found 304 objects
7. The scan finished with a note that "some objects could not be removed," and I chose to have it run at the next system startup
8. Ran Spybot (found some more ad/spyware), and cleaned those up
9. I think now I restarted the computer, thus yielding the aforementioned problem

Any help/support would be appreciated.

1) Try another user, if you have one.
2) Reboot into safe mode, restore to a point before this started happening.
